History:
The Indian Tower, located in Nazareth, Pennsylvania, was constructed in 1893 as a memorial to the Native American tribes who once inhabited the region. It is next to a small burial plot. The tower stands on a hill in Indian Head Park and was built by local residents to honor the area's native history and commemorate the Native American influence in the Lehigh Valley. The structure is made of fieldstone and was designed as a watchtower, offering expansive views of the surrounding countryside.
The tower was named for its location and its connection to local Native American history. It is said that the area was once a gathering place for indigenous tribes before European settlers arrived. The tower was also a popular tourist attraction in the early 20th century, offering a panoramic view of the scenic landscape. Over the years, the Indian Tower has been preserved as part of the region's cultural heritage and continues to be a historic landmark.
The Indian Tower is also known for its paranormal activity. Due to its age, historical significance, and association with Native American history, the site has been a subject of ghost stories and local legends.
